【计算机类职业资格】国家二级VF笔试-试卷139及答案解析.doc
《【计算机类职业资格】国家二级VF笔试-试卷139及答案解析.doc》由会员分享,可在线阅读,更多相关《【计算机类职业资格】国家二级VF笔试-试卷139及答案解析.doc(14页珍藏版)》请在麦多课文档分享上搜索。
1、国家二级 VF 笔试-试卷 139 及答案解析(总分:102.00,做题时间:90 分钟)一、选择题(总题数:32,分数:70.00)1.选择题()下列各题 A、B、C、D 四个选项中,只有一个选项是正确的,请将正确选项涂写在答题卡相应位置上。_2.数据的存储结构是指( )。(分数:2.00)A.存储在外存中的数据B.数据所占的存储空间量C.数据在计算机中的顺序存储方式D.数据的逻辑结构在计算机中的表示3.对于长度为 n 的线性表,在最坏情况下,下列各排序法所对应的比较次数中正确的是( )。(分数:2.00)A.冒泡排序为 n2B.冒泡排序为 nC.快速排序为 nD.快速排序为 n(n-1)2
2、4.栈和队列的共同点是( )。(分数:2.00)A.都是先进先出B.都是先进后出C.只允许在端点处插入和删除元素D.没有共同特点5.有下列二叉树,对此二叉树巾序遍历的结果为( )。 (分数:2.00)A.ABCEDFB.ABCUEFC.ECBDFAD.ECFDBA6.对建立良好的程序设计风格,下列描述中正确的是( )。(分数:2.00)A.程序应该简单、清晰、可读性好B.符号名的命名只需要符合语法C.充分考虑程序的执行效率D.程序的注释可有可无7.下列叙述中正确的是( )。(分数:2.00)A.在面向对象的程序设计中,各个对象之间具有密切的关系B.在面向对象的程序设计中,各个对象都是公用的C.
3、在面向对象的程序设计中,各个对象之间相对独立,相互依赖性小D.上述 3 种说法都不对8.为了提高软件模块的独立性,模块之间最好是( )。(分数:2.00)A.控制耦合B.公共耦合C.内容耦合D.数据耦合9.数据独立性是数据库技术的重要特点之一。所谓数据独立性是指( )。(分数:2.00)A.数据与程序独立存放B.不同的数据被存放在不同的文件中C.不同的数据只能被对应的应用程序所使用D.以上三种说法都不对10.下列描述巾正确的是( )。(分数:2.00)A.软件工程只是解决软件项目的管理问题B.软件工程主要解决软件产品的生产率问题C.软件工程的主要思想是强调在软件开发过程中需要应用工程化原则D.
4、软件工程只是解决软件开发过程中的技术问题11.对关系 s 和 R 进行集合运算,结果中既包含 S 中的所有元组也包含 R 中的所有元组,这样的集合运算称为( )。(分数:2.00)A.并运算B.交运算C.差运算D.积运算12.在 Visual FoxPro rfl,可以对项目中的数据、文档等进行集中管理,并可以对项目进行创建和维护的是( )。(分数:2.00)A.工具栏B.设计器C.文件编辑器D.项目管理器13.假定系统日期是 2008 年 1 月 13 日,则执行命令 PI=MOD(YEAR(DATEO)-2000,10)后PI 的值是( )。(分数:2.00)A.012008B.-8C.8
5、D.014.ROUND(6165,2)的函数值是( )。(分数:2.00)A.616B.617C.620D.616015.Visual FoxPro DBMS 基于的数据模型是( )。(分数:2.00)A.层次型B.关系型C.网状型D.混合型16.假设有部门和职员两个实体,每个职员只能属于一个部门,一个部门可以有多名职员,则部门与职员实体之间的联系类型是( )联系。(分数:2.00)A.m:nB.1:mC.m:kD.1:117.用程序计算一个整数的各位数字之和,在下划线处应填写的语句是( )。 SET TALK OFF INPUX“X=”FO X S=0 DO WHILE X!=0 S=S+M
6、OD(X,10) ENDDO ? S SET TALK ON(分数:2.00)A.X=int(X10)B.X=int(X10)C.X=X-int(X10)D.X=X-int(X% 10)18.为学生表建立普通索引,要求按“学号”字段升序排列,如果学号(C,4)相等,则按成绩(N,3)升序排列,下列语句正确的是( )。(分数:2.00)A.INDEX ON 学号,成绩 TO XHCJB.INDEX ON 学号+成绩 TO XHCJC.INDEX ON 学号,STR(成绩,3)TO XHCJD.INDEX ON 学号+STR(成绩,3)TO XHCJ19.设 MYDBF 数据库中共有 10 条记录
7、,执行如下命令序列: USE MY GoTO 2 DISPLAY ALL ? RECNO() 执行最后一条命令后,屏幕显示的值是( )。(分数:2.00)A.2B.3C.10D.1120.在 Visual FoxPro 中进行参照完整性设置时,要想设置成:当更改父表中的主关键字段或候选关键字段时,自动更改所有相关子表记录中的对应值,应选择( )。(分数:2.00)A.限制(Rest rjct)B.忽略(Ignore)C.级联(Cascade)D.级联(Cascade)或限制(Restrict)21.在 Visual FoxPro 中,对字段设置默认值,下列描述中正确的是( )。(分数:2.00
8、)A.数据库表可以设置字段默认值B.自由表可以设置字段默认值C.自由表和数据库表都可以设置字段默认值D.自由表和数据库表都不能设置字段默认值22.ABCDBF 是一个具有两个备注型字段的数据库文件,使用 COPY TO PSQ 命令进行复制操作,其结果将( )。(分数:2.00)A.得到一个新的数据库文件B.得到一个新的数据库文件和一个新的备注文件C.得到一个新的数据库文件和两个新的备注文件D.显示出错误信息,表明不能复制具有备注型字段的数据库文件23.在 Visual FoxPro 中,下列叙述错误的是( )。(分数:2.00)A.关系也被称作表B.数据库文件不存储用户数据C.表文件的扩展名
9、是DbfD.多个表存储在一个物理文件中24.在表单设计器的属性窗口中设置表单或其他控件对象的属性时,下列叙述正确的是( )。(分数:2.00)A.表单的属性描述了表单的事件和方法B.以斜体字显示的属性值表示为只读,不可以修改C.属性窗口只包括属性、方法和事件列表框和对象框D.以上都不正确25.修改表单 MyForm 的正确命令是( )。(分数:2.00)A.MODIFY COMMAND MyFormB.MODIFY FORM MvFormC.DU MyFormD.EDTT MyForm26.视图设计器中包括的选项卡有( )。(分数:2.00)A.连接、显示、排序依据B.更新条件、排序依据、显示
10、C.显示、排序依据、分组依据D.更新条件、筛选、字段27.要控制两个表中数据的完整性和一致性可以设置“参照完整性”,要求这两个表( )。(分数:2.00)A.是同一数据库存中的两个表B.不同数据库存巾的两张表C.两个自由表D.一个是数据库存表,另一个是自由表28.在表单设计中,关键字 Thisform 表示( )。(分数:2.00)A.当前对象的直接容器对象B.当前对象所在的表单C.当前对象D.当前对象所存的表单集29.在 visual FoxPro 中,说明数组的命令是( )。(分数:2.00)A.DIMEN SION 和 ARRAYB.DECLARE 和 ARRAYC.DIMENSION
11、和 DECLARED.只有 DIMENSION30.下列关于数据环境及表间关系的说法,正确的是( )。(分数:2.00)A.数据环境是对象,关系不是对象B.数据环境不是对象,关系是对象C.数据环境和关系都不是对象D.数据环境是对象,关系是数据环境中的对象31.在当前目录下有数据表文件“XSdbf”,执行下列 SQL 语句后( )。SELECT*FROM XS INTO CURSOR XS ORDER BY 学号(分数:2.00)A.生成一个按“学号”升序的临时表文件,将原来的 XSdbf 文件覆盖B.生成一个按“学号”降序的临时表文件,将原来的 XSdbf 文件覆盖C.不会生成新的排序文件,保
12、持原数据表内容不变D.系统提示出错信息使用如下数据。 部门(部门号 C(2)、部门名称 C(10) 职工(部门号 C(2)、职工号 C(4)、姓名 C(8)、基本工资 N(7,2)(分数:10.00)(1).检索有职工的基本工资大于或等于“11”部门巾任意一名职工工资的“部门号”,正确的语句是( )。(分数:2.00)A.SELECT DISTINCT 部门号 FROM 职丁 WHERE 基本工资=ANY (SELECT 基本工资 FROM 职工 WHERE 部门号=“11”)B.SELECT DISTINCT 部门号 FROM 职工 WHERE 基本工资=ALL (SELECT 基本工资 F
13、ROM 职工 WHERE 部门号=“11”)C.SELECT DISTINCT 部门号 FROM 职工 WHERE 基本工资=ANY (SELECT MAX(基本工资)FROM 职工 WHERE 部门号=“11”)D.SELECT DISTINCT 部门号 FROM 职工 WHERE 基本工资=ALL (SELECT MIN(基本工资)FROM 职工 WHERE 部门号=“11”)(2).检索最少有 5 名职工的每个部门的职工基本工资的总额,正确的语句是( )。(分数:2.00)A.SELECT 部门号,COtJNT(*),SUM(基本工资)FROM 职工 HAVTNG COUNT(*)=5B
14、.SELECT 部门号,COUNT(*),SUM(基本工资)FROM 职工 GROUP BY 基本工资 HAVING COUNT(*)=5C.SEL,ECT 部门号,COUNT(*),SUM(基本工资)FROM 职工 GROUP BY 部门号 HAVING COUNT(*)=5D.SELECl、部门号,COUNT(*),SUM(基本工资)FROM 职工 GROUP BY 部门号 WHERE COUNT(*)=5(3).向职工表中插入一条记录的正确语句是( )。(分数:2.00)A.APPEND BLANK 职工 VALUES(“33”,“3305”,“李运来”,“270000”)B.APPEN
15、D INTO 职工 VALUES(“33”,“3305”,“李运来”9270000)C.INSERT INTO 职工 VALUES(“33”“9113305”,“李运来”“911270000”)D.INSERT INTO 职工 VALUES(“3311”,“13305”,“李运来”,270000)(4).为“部门”表增加一个“人数”字段,类型为整型,正确的语句是( )。(分数:2.00)A.ALTER TABLE 部门 ALTER 人数 lB.ALTER TABLE 部门 ALTER FIELDS 人数 1C.ALTER TABLE 部门 ADD 人数 1D.ALTER TABLE 部门 AD
16、D FIELDS 人数 1(5).检索每个部门的职工工资的总和,要求显示“部门名称”和“基本工资”,正确的语句是( )。(分数:2.00)A.SELECT 部门名称,SUM(基本工资)FROM 部门,职工 WHERE 职工部门号=部门部门号 ORDER BY 部门号B.SELECT 部门名称,SUM(基本工资)FROM 部门,职工 WHERE 职工部门号=部门部门号 GROUP BY 部门号C.SELECT 部门名称,SUM(基本工资)FROM 部门,职工 WHlERE 职工部门号=部门部门号 ORDRE BY 职工部门号D.SELECT 部门名称,SUM(基本工资)FROM 部门,职工 WH
17、ERE 职工部门号=部门部门号 GROUP BY 职工部门号二、填空题(总题数:16,分数:32.00)32.填空题(每空)请将每一个空的正确答案写在答题卡上。注意:以命令关键字填空的必须拼写完整。(分数:2.00)_33.顺序存储方法是把逻辑上相邻的结点存储在物理位置 1 的存储单元中。(分数:2.00)填空项 1:_34.在关系运算中, 1 运算是在指定的关系中选取所有满足给定条件的元组,构成一个新的关系,而这个新的关系是原关系的一个子集。(分数:2.00)填空项 1:_35.二分法查找仅限于这样的表:表中的数据元素必须有序,其存储结构必须是 1。(分数:2.00)填空项 1:_36.在数
18、据库管理系统提供的数据定义语言、数据操纵语言和数据控制语言中, 1 负责数据的模式定义与数据的物理存取构建。(分数:2.00)填空项 1:_37.在一个容量为 25 的循环队列中,若头指针 front=9,尾指针 rear=16,则该循环队列中共有 1 个元素。(分数:2.00)填空项 1:_38.AT(“IS”,THAT Is A NEWBOOK”)的运算结果是 1 。(分数:2.00)填空项 1:_39.单击表单中的命令按钮,要求弹出一个”您好!”的消息对话框,应该在命令按钮的 Click 事件中编写代码: 1 (“您好”)。(分数:2.00)填空项 1:_40.为了把多对多的联系分解成两
19、个一对多联系所建立的“组带表”中,应该包含两个表的 1。(分数:2.00)填空项 1:_41.SQL 插入记录的命令是 INSERT,删除命令是 1,修改记录的命令是 2。(分数:2.00)填空项 1:_42.mod(17,-3)函数的返回值是 1。(分数:2.00)填空项 1:_43.在 SQL 语句中,为了避免查询到的记录重复,可用 1 短语。(分数:2.00)填空项 1:_44.在 visual FoxPro 中,可以使用 1 语句跳出 SCANENDSCAN 循环体外执行 ENDSCAN 后面的语句。(分数:2.00)填空项 1:_45.设有学生表 XS(学号,课程号,成绩),用 SQ
20、L 语句检索每个学生的成绩总和的语句是: SELECT 学号,SUM(成绩)FROM XS 1 。(分数:2.00)填空项 1:_46.函数 VAL(“120601”)的参数类型为 1 。(分数:2.00)填空项 1:_47.CTOD(“04-01-01”)+20 的结果是 1 。(分数:2.00)填空项 1:_国家二级 VF 笔试-试卷 139 答案解析(总分:102.00,做题时间:90 分钟)一、选择题(总题数:32,分数:70.00)1.选择题()下列各题 A、B、C、D 四个选项中,只有一个选项是正确的,请将正确选项涂写在答题卡相应位置上。_解析:2.数据的存储结构是指( )。(分数
21、:2.00)A.存储在外存中的数据B.数据所占的存储空间量C.数据在计算机中的顺序存储方式D.数据的逻辑结构在计算机中的表示 解析:3.对于长度为 n 的线性表,在最坏情况下,下列各排序法所对应的比较次数中正确的是( )。(分数:2.00)A.冒泡排序为 n2B.冒泡排序为 nC.快速排序为 nD.快速排序为 n(n-1)2 解析:4.栈和队列的共同点是( )。(分数:2.00)A.都是先进先出B.都是先进后出C.只允许在端点处插入和删除元素 D.没有共同特点解析:5.有下列二叉树,对此二叉树巾序遍历的结果为( )。 (分数:2.00)A.ABCEDFB.ABCUEFC.ECBDFAD.ECF
22、DBA 解析:6.对建立良好的程序设计风格,下列描述中正确的是( )。(分数:2.00)A.程序应该简单、清晰、可读性好 B.符号名的命名只需要符合语法C.充分考虑程序的执行效率D.程序的注释可有可无解析:7.下列叙述中正确的是( )。(分数:2.00)A.在面向对象的程序设计中,各个对象之间具有密切的关系B.在面向对象的程序设计中,各个对象都是公用的C.在面向对象的程序设计中,各个对象之间相对独立,相互依赖性小 D.上述 3 种说法都不对解析:8.为了提高软件模块的独立性,模块之间最好是( )。(分数:2.00)A.控制耦合B.公共耦合C.内容耦合D.数据耦合 解析:9.数据独立性是数据库技
23、术的重要特点之一。所谓数据独立性是指( )。(分数:2.00)A.数据与程序独立存放B.不同的数据被存放在不同的文件中C.不同的数据只能被对应的应用程序所使用D.以上三种说法都不对 解析:10.下列描述巾正确的是( )。(分数:2.00)A.软件工程只是解决软件项目的管理问题B.软件工程主要解决软件产品的生产率问题C.软件工程的主要思想是强调在软件开发过程中需要应用工程化原则 D.软件工程只是解决软件开发过程中的技术问题解析:11.对关系 s 和 R 进行集合运算,结果中既包含 S 中的所有元组也包含 R 中的所有元组,这样的集合运算称为( )。(分数:2.00)A.并运算 B.交运算C.差运
- 1.请仔细阅读文档,确保文档完整性,对于不预览、不比对内容而直接下载带来的问题本站不予受理。
- 2.下载的文档,不会出现我们的网址水印。
- 3、该文档所得收入(下载+内容+预览)归上传者、原创作者;如果您是本文档原作者,请点此认领!既往收益都归您。
下载文档到电脑,查找使用更方便
5000 积分 0人已下载
下载 | 加入VIP,交流精品资源 |
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 计算机 职业资格 国家 二级 VF 笔试 试卷 139 答案 解析 DOC
